The size Processing 4 is massive (hundreds of megabytes) compared to Processing 3. The main problem is that the JavaFX library is enormous, so I'm probably gonna have to move it to a separate library ...
A modern library system created using JavaFX without FXML, fully coded manually using Java. The system includes login, dashboards, book management, loaning, returning, and full Oracle DB support.